Transaction 949fa327f808d2cc110bfca4c5fc18e2a76bbbd56c0df379b0fe8321ea63ef79

1 Input
2 Outputs
  • 949fa327f808d2cc110bfca4c5fc18e2a76bbbd56c0df379b0fe8321ea63ef79:0
  • value  8480375
    address  15gh2weTVQLHpPVm2QCeJF1CeqBLCDdyFJ
  • 949fa327f808d2cc110bfca4c5fc18e2a76bbbd56c0df379b0fe8321ea63ef79:1
  • value  375102141
    address  36bePnJP62dfJmRLcK6qbk92FSAhR9aBJs